Madhav Copper Limited (MCL) — Net Asset Quality Index
Madhav Copper Limited (MCL) has a Net Asset Quality Index of 45.7% as of September 2025. This metric measures the proportion of total assets financed by shareholders' equity — total assets of Rs1.02 Billion minus total liabilities of Rs553.86 Million yields net assets of Rs465.48 Million.
